I see where you're coming from—budgets are tight. A method folks don't always consider is digital review copies. If you're active on platforms like NetGalley or Edelweiss, you can request advance reader copies for free in exchange for an honest review. It's not guaranteed you'll get approved, especially for a popular title, but building a review profile can open doors. It's a legitimate channel within the publishing industry. Just remember, it's for review purposes, not just casual reading.

Check if your workplace or any organizations you belong to have a corporate library or learning budget. Some companies offer services like Audible or Scribd subscriptions as perks. It's a long shot, but worth investigating if you have an employee portal with benefits info. You might already have access to a service that includes the book without realizing it.

I always look for legal ways to access free reads. Project Gutenberg is my go-to—it offers over 60,000 free eBooks, mostly classics like 'Pride and Prejudice' and 'Frankenstein,' since their copyrights have expired.
Another treasure trove is Open Library, which lets you borrow modern books digitally, just like a physical library. For contemporary works, many authors offer free short stories or first chapters on their websites or platforms like Wattpad. Libraries also partner with apps like Libby or Hoopla, where you can borrow eBooks with a valid library card. It’s a win-win: you get free books, and creators still get support through library purchases.
